“One Nation, One People” – Grange announces theme for Jamaica 57



Jamaica’s 57th anniversary of Independence is to be celebrated under the theme “One Nation, One People.”

This has been disclosed by Minister of Culture, Gender, Entertainment and Sport, the Honourable Olivia Grange.

2019 Festival Song Road Tour Rolls into St. Elizabeth, St. Catherine this Weekend

The 2019 Jamaica Festival Song finalists will roll into the southern parishes of St. Elizabeth and St. Catherine this weekend, as they continue their month-long, island-wide, free, performance road tour, aimed at bringing the impending Independence spirit to the masses.

Children’s Gospel Sweet 16 Grand Final Rescheduled for this Sunday, June 9

Kingston, Jamaica: The “Sweet 16” Grand Final of the 2019 Jamaica Children’s Gospel Song Competition has received a new date and venue and will be hosted this Sunday, June 9 at Church on the Rock, 7 Clifton Drive, Kingston 8, beginning at 6:30 p.m.

TEN TO VIE FOR 2019 MISS KINGSTON & ST. ANDREW FESTIVAL QUEEN TITLE ON JUNE 9

Kingston Jamaica: Ten culturally aware, intelligent and poised young women will vie for the title of Miss Kingston and St. Andrew Festival Queen 2019 at the competition’s grand coronation on Sunday, June 9 at the Little Theatre in Kingston.

2019 Jamaica Festival Song Competition to Launch this Thursday, May 16

Kingston, Jamaica:  The 2019 Jamaica Festival Song Competition will see its official launch being held this Thursday, May 16 at Emancipation Park in Kingston, beginning at 6:00 p.m.

Creative Writing Entries to Close Today, Friday, May 10

The 2019 Jamaica Creative Writing Competition and Exhibition, a staple programme in the Jamaica Cultural Development Commission’s (JCDC) festival calendar, will stop accepting entries today, Friday, May 10 at 3:30 pm.
